PK_boolean_no_effect_t |
typedef int PK_boolean_no_effect_t;
PK_boolean_no_effect_t has two values:
PK_boolean_no_effect_basic_c Reporting when a no effect boolean
occurs (i.e. the target is unaffected
by the tools) is compatible with V16.1
and earlier.
PK_boolean_no_effect_advanced_c No effect reported wherever possible.
